| """Stateless Gradio web demo for the DocField Extract pipeline. | |
| Architecture rule 1: this module is a thin presentation wrapper over | |
| ``core.process_document``. No pipeline logic lives here; the web layer only | |
| calls the core and renders what it returns. In particular the renderers *read* | |
| ``result.decision`` -- they never re-derive it. | |
| Rule codes appear only in the details tab. ``_RULE_COPY`` carries the | |
| plain-language wording and ``tests/test_web.py`` fails if a rule ever lacks an | |
| entry, so a new rule cannot silently leak "H5" into the user-facing surface. | |
| Privacy (NFR-2 / docs/04_project_setup.md): the free Gemini tier may train on | |
| inputs, so a visible notice is shown at the top of every page. Only synthetic | |
| or publicly-available documents should be uploaded to the hosted demo. | |
| Stateless: nothing is written to disk or a database. The watcher owns | |
| persistence; the demo renders results and discards them. | |
| Launch: ``uv run python -m docfield.web.app`` (or via this module's | |
| ``if __name__ == "__main__"`` block). | |
| """ | |

| _HOW_IT_WORKS = """ | |
| A language model reads the document and fills in the fields. It is not trusted | |
| on its own. A fixed set of arithmetic and presence checks then runs over what it | |
| produced: do the line items add up, does the subtotal plus tax equal the total, | |
| is there a total at all. Those checks are ordinary code, not the model, so they | |
| give the same answer every time. | |
| If every must-pass check clears and confidence is high enough, the document is | |
| accepted automatically. Otherwise it goes to review. Review is the safe default, | |
| not a failure: a field that needs a second look costs a few seconds of someone's | |
| attention, while a wrong number that gets accepted is copied onward silently. | |
| """.strip() | |
